The Bollywood may not forget Rekha, Sridevi, Hemamalini and Jayaprada who all sizzled on the silver screens with the greats like Amitabh Bachchan, Jeetendra, Rishi Kapoor and others in 1980s. These three from the South Indian Industry made such an impact in their time that hardly other names were able to reach a level of prominence.
While Rekha had her own way of living and was always in the news, Sridevi and Hemamalini decided to settle with their families and confining their reel life to appearance just here and there on TV, Jayapradha alone went ahead with pursuing her political career to become a people’s leader as MP from Rampur.
But, no one knows where the destiny could lead them to. She started a production house and made a Telugu film with her son only to face a severe loss. Then came a Kannada Film and a Bengali Film. There could be no serious results from these ventures.
This lady who is a great dancer is now back in a Hindi film. She will act as a mother to Shilpa Shetty in “The Desire”. This film is a Indo-Chinese one in which the Chinese superstar Xia Yu also stars. Shilpa plays a Odyssey dancer. Recently there was a news about this movie being shot at Kerala where Shilpa’s head was made up by a famous artist Vidyadhar who turned it to look like a tonsured head.
Well, the news is about Jayaprada who says that she was waiting for almost ten years to do one such role she has been assigned to do so in “The Desire”. She also conveys tactically her willingness to do any fitting role in the movies as demanded by the story line, so we are now ready with a mother and grandmother who will don the screens for years from now.
